
Le Salon Dada
A 6-course degustation menu, immersive entertainment and a Surrealist twist
Whimsical, lavish, eccentric, imaginative. Join us for an evening of Surrealist fashion, theatre, food and deviant art.
Liberate the imagination.
Created by Marc Kuzma, also known as Claire de Lune (El Circo, El Circo Rouge, El Circo Blanc, Risqué Revue and Vampire Stories).
The Surrealist dinner is inspired in part by the Rothschild’s lavish costume parties of the 1970s and the art of Salvador Dali, Joan Miro, Marcel Duchamp and René Magritte.
6 courses and immersive entertainment including Dada cocktail and canapés on arrival, soup, appetizer, entrée, main and dessert, but not as you may expect…
3 hours of non-stop food and entertainment, starting at 5.30pm.
